Res Commun Chem Pathol Pharmacol. 1990 Apr;68(1):125-8.
The effect of a protein-free extract from calf blood on hypoxic cell injury was studied in experiments with primary cultures of isolated hepatocytes. At concentrations above 1 mg/ml the extract produced marked protection. At 4 h of anaerobic incubation at 37 degrees C only 20% of cells were damaged as compared to 50% of the anaerobic control incubation. These data demonstrate the presence of a factor in the blood extract which protects against hypoxic cell injury.
